Summary
This pilot study found that a proposed trial protocol for ketamine to prevent depression relapse after electroconvulsive therapy (ECT) was not feasible due to recruitment and dropout issues.
Area of Science:
- Neuroscience
- Psychiatry
- Clinical Trials
Background:
- Depression relapse is common after electroconvulsive therapy (ECT), occurring in 40% of patients within 6 months.
- Ketamine shows antidepressant effects, but its use in preventing ECT-related depression relapse has not been studied.
- This pilot trial (NCT02414932) aimed to assess the feasibility of a trial protocol for ketamine in depression relapse prevention.
Purpose of the Study:
- To evaluate the feasibility of a clinical trial protocol for ketamine in preventing depression relapse post-ECT.
- To identify reasons for challenges in recruitment, randomization, and participant dropout.
- To inform the design of future clinical trials investigating intravenous ketamine for depression relapse.
Main Methods:
- Patients with unipolar depression undergoing ECT were monitored for response using the Hamilton Rating Scale for Depression.
- Eligible responders were invited to a randomized phase comparing ketamine infusions to midazolam.
- Participants were followed for 6 months to assess relapse rates.
Main Results:
- Only 68% of eligible patients were recruited to the monitoring phase, and 26% of responders consented to the treatment phase.
- All 6 randomized participants (3 ketamine, 3 midazolam) dropped out before completing the 4-week treatment.
- Reasons for dropout included practical issues with infusions and lack of interest post-ECT response.
Conclusions:
- The proposed treatment protocol is not suitable for a definitive trial at this center.
- Findings highlight significant challenges in implementing intravenous ketamine trials for depression relapse prevention.
- Information on dropout reasons can guide future trial designs in this area.

Long-term depression, or LTD, is one of the ways by which synaptic plasticity—changes in the strength of chemical synapses—can occur in the brain. LTD is the process of synaptic weakening that occurs over time between pre and postsynaptic neuronal connections. The synaptic weakening of LTD works in opposition to synaptic strengthening by long-term potentiation (LTP) and together are the main mechanisms that underlie learning and memory.

Pilot relaying is a type of differential protection used in power systems. It compares electrical quantities at the terminals of equipment via a communication channel instead of direct relay interconnection. This method is essential for transmission lines where the terminals are far apart, typically up to 80 km for lines with 69 to 115 kV ratings.
